    The separation between two masses of 1 kg and 2 kg is 50 cm. Under mutual gravitational force, the acceleration of 2kg mass is

    A)  \[5.3\times {{10}^{-10}}m{{s}^{-2}}\]    

    B)  \[2.65\times {{10}^{-10}}m{{s}^{-2}}\]

    C)  \[3.65\times {{10}^{-10}}m{{s}^{-2}}\]  

    D)  None of these

    Correct Answer: B

    Solution :

                    The gravitational force acting on two particle is \[F=\frac{G\,{{m}_{1}}\,{{m}_{2}}}{{{r}^{2}}}\] \[=\frac{6.67\times {{10}^{-11}}\times (1)\times (2)}{{{(0.5)}^{2}}}\] \[=5.3\times {{10}^{-10}}N\] (in magnitude) The acceleration of 2 kg mass is \[{{a}_{2}}=\frac{F}{{{m}_{2}}}=\frac{5.3\times {{10}^{-10}}}{2}=2.65\times {{10}^{-10}}m{{s}^{-2}}\] This acceleration is towards 1 kg mass.
